The Petunia Pickle Bottom Boxy Backpack Diaper Bag in Evening in Islington offers a roomy 34-liter capacity with multiple pockets, including four bottle holders and a zip-out changing station. Crafted with a PVC-free glazed exterior and premium hardware, it features magnetic and snap closures for security. Designed for versatility, it can be carried as a backpack, crossbody, or attached to a stroller (clips sold separately), making it the ultimate modern diaper bag for on-the-go parents.

Pretty but... Pretty pricey for what it is
I was looking for a backpack and/or messenger style diaper bag because my tote had become too clunky and too hard to manage and I could only envision that getting more annoying as my son becomes more mobile. I had never heard of Petunia Pickle Bottom bags before, but loved the look of them - the boxy style, the pretty prints, the diaper portion in the front, the convertibility of the straps. I couldn't wait to get it, but I have been a bit disappointed and have mixed feelings about it.The bag is even prettier in person than in the picture and I love the glazed cotton fabric and the beautiful embroidery. The changing pad is larger than I expected and I like that you can access the diapers and wipes by lifting the flap (which has magnetic closure and snaps - so nice) so you don't have to unzip and unroll the changing pad if you don't need it. That being said, I can only fit 3 size 3 Honest Company diapers, the PPB wipes container and a small tube of Honest Company diaper rash ointment. While 3 diapers is enough for a daytime outing, it is not enough for travel.I think I was also a bit disappointed by the material on the inside. It is a light grey cotton fabric that isn't water resistant and looks kinda cheap. There is 1 zippered compartment, 2 slot compartments and 2 uninsulated bottle compartments (the 2 compartments on the outside are not insulated either!). Once those are filled up, there is not much room left for anything else. My small cosmetic bag, thin wallet and a change of clothes are really all I can fit in there. The bag, once loaded, is very heavy and hangs at an odd angle on my back, so I will probably end up having to use it as a messenger. Either way I carry it, I will probably be worried about the straps; they seem to be made of a thin seatbelt-like material and seem like they won't stay in position well and will have to be adjusted constantly.I am wary about carrying it, too, because there are not metal "feet" on the bottom to prevent it from getting dirty AND it can't be washed or dry cleaned.I kinda hate that I spent this much money on this bag and am so impressed with its beauty but so disappointed in its functionality. I will probably carry it for a while and then sell it. I had been considering the JuJuBe BFF bag and wish I would have gone with that instead.
